Transaction 0124911ff778143ca532ef8ef280c889cc765392d0d71423a4efc58a76e346f4
1 Input
1 Output
-
0124911ff778143ca532ef8ef280c889cc765392d0d71423a4efc58a76e346f4:0
- value
- 67256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6c5ebb48bc95a8f3905f75215b343179a785428 OP_EQUAL
- address
- 3QBqFWMoq3UCYJhyiVSfKKHkqoyh5BBwGZ